For Nostr clients: Damus (iOS) and Iris (web) are solid; many also like Coracle or Snort for a clean feed. Wallet depends what you need—zaps vs on-chain. For zaps-only, native client linking (e.g. Damus + Alby) works; for broader use, people often use a separate wallet and link via NIP-07. Cheers.
